Ball Mount Shank With 1 Inch Hole Spacing In Shank  

Question:

I have an older model Draw-tite light duty weight distribution hitch. I believe it has the 7390 ball mount. The hole spacing is 1inch center to center. The bolts that mount the head to the ball mounts are 3inch apart. I have 2-1/2inch of and need about 4-1/2inch I am looking for something with a longer with either a 1inch or 1-1/2inch hole spacing. The RP3215 looks like the correct size, but what is the hole spacing? I could use either 1inch or 1-1/2inch spacing, but it looks like 1-1/4inch is pretty standard. Do you have any suggestions?

0

Expert Reply:

The MaxxTow Adjustable-Height Ball Mount - 2" Hitch - 10" Drop, 8" Rise - 5,000 lbs # MT70067 has a similar shank and is the only option I can find that may have more drop for you with 1 inch increments. This ball mount is rated for 5000 lbs.
